Preserving Paradise: Ethical Travel Practices in Tanzania
Tanzania, an Eden of breathtaking landscapes and rich cultural heritage, lures travelers from across the globe. Yet, with this influx comes a responsibility to ensure its pristine environment and vibrant communities. By embracing ethical travel practices, we can offset our impact and participate in preserving this paradise for generations to come.
Choosing eco-friendly accommodations that champion sustainable tourism is a crucial first step. These lodgings often utilize renewable energy sources, reduce water usage, and value local materials in their construction.
Furthermore, engaging with local communities in a respectful and authentic way enriches the travel experience while boosting local economies. By acquiring goods and services directly from artisans and farmers, we support their livelihoods and sustain traditional crafts and practices.
Remember that every interaction, from choosing souvenirs to observing local customs, has an impact. By adopting mindful travel habits, we can all participate a role in ensuring that Tanzania's charm endures for years to come.

Embark on a Responsible Tanzania Adventure: Leave Only Footprints
Tanzania's breathtaking landscapes and diverse wildlife offer an unparalleled adventure experience. But as you explore this spectacular nation, it's crucial to remember the importance of responsible travel. "Leave only footprints, take only memories" is a mantra that should guide every step on your journey.
- Respect local cultures: Tanzania boasts a rich tapestry of indigenous groups with unique ways of life. Learn about their customs before you go and be mindful of your interactions.
- Conserve Tanzania's natural heritage: Stay on marked trails, avoid littering, and choose eco-friendly accommodations to minimize your impact on the environment.
- Support local enterprises: Opt for locally owned tour operators, purchase souvenirs from artisans, and dine at restaurants that feature traditional Tanzanian cuisine. This helps empower communities and ensures sustainable tourism practices.
By embracing these principles, you can experience the magic of Tanzania while preserving its natural and cultural treasures for generations to come.
